Using techniques developed over centuries; rings, necklaces, earrings, pendants, and other accessories are meticulously handcrafted in Celuk which has evolved into the center of the Balinese jewelry making industry. A trade started by only a handful of Pande (smith) clans, jewelry making has now become a thriving industry with just about every home doubling as a gold and silver production studio. The road from Batubulan to Celuk to Sukawati is alive with dozens of stunning galleries and shops brimful of lush silver and gold jewelry and other colorful Balinese handicrafts.
